add osmo_bts_features_names: short BTS feature strings

This will be used by osmo-bts-omldummy to parse features strings from
the cmdline.

Note that osmo_bts_feature_name() already exists to return the longer
descriptive value_strings from osmo_bts_features_descs (_descs!).
Luckily that misses the plural 'features' in the name, so that I can
still add a properly named osmo_bts_features_name() function that only
returns the name, matching the common pattern used in osmocom code.
